Those pic are AWESOME!, is Floyd going to come with a strap for his guitar?

Yes...made of fabric, with two small plastic "ends" that pop on to the guitar. The suitar will also be able to be connected to the amp with a small PVC tube.

and I like Fozzie's glasses and for Gonzo the exclusive is his stunt suit going to be the same color or differnt from the regular Gonzo?

All different colors, for the cape, outfit and cannon. The helmet is NOT removable. Otherwise, he wouldn't be all that different from the other Gonzo.

Again, I'll ask, Ken how will Gonzo's cannon operate?

A small disc is placed into the cannon on two grooves. You push the disc down into the cannon then place Gonzo, hands up, into the cannon. A small button in the back is depressed and out he pops.

Ken, will the figures that come with playsets have their own little display bases like the solo figures?

Unfortunately no. We went with adding extra stuff to the playsets in lieu of the costs associated with the logo base. There are two pegs on each logo base though, so you are not locked into displaying one character per base. You can use one peg for one fig and one peg for another. The bases are fairly wide to allow for that. However, note that Beaker does not have peg holes in his feet. My bad.
